Latest Patents

Phillip Harsh holds a patent for "Superhydrophobic and oleophobic coatings with low VOC binder systems." This patent describes coating compositions that utilize low amounts of volatile organic compounds to create superhydrophobic (SH) and/or oleophobic (OP) surfaces. The resulting coatings and coated surfaces have a variety of uses, including their ability to prevent or resist water, dirt, and ice from attaching to a surface.
